Foros del Web » Programación para mayores de 30 ;) » Java »

java.lang NullPointerException

Estas en el tema de java.lang NullPointerException en el foro de Java en Foros del Web. Solicitud sol = new Solicitud(); if (busquedaSolicitudesVo.getNombre_solicitante() != null) sol.getDatosSolicitante().setNombreSolicitante(bus quedaSolicitudesVo.getNombre_solicitante()); else fixedExcludedParams.add("nombre_solicitante"); He pasado por el debug un codigo el cual ejecuta un test ...
  #1 (permalink)  
Antiguo 07/04/2011, 02:55
 
Fecha de Ingreso: abril-2011
Mensajes: 4
Antigüedad: 13 años
Puntos: 0
java.lang NullPointerException

Solicitud sol = new Solicitud();

if (busquedaSolicitudesVo.getNombre_solicitante() != null)
sol.getDatosSolicitante().setNombreSolicitante(bus quedaSolicitudesVo.getNombre_solicitante());
else fixedExcludedParams.add("nombre_solicitante");

He pasado por el debug un codigo el cual ejecuta un test de jUnit y me corta justo en la linea que hace el if.

Me sale un null pointer exception pero no encuentro nada raro. Alguien me puede ayudar?

Gracias
  #2 (permalink)  
Antiguo 07/04/2011, 07:44
Avatar de Ronruby  
Fecha de Ingreso: julio-2008
Ubicación: 18°30'N, 69°59'W
Mensajes: 4.879
Antigüedad: 15 años, 9 meses
Puntos: 416
Respuesta: java.lang NullPointerException

Usa un try-catch

Código Javascript:
Ver original
  1. try {
  2.   sol.getDatosSolicitante().setNombreSolicitante(busquedaSolicitudesVo.getNombre_solicitante());
  3. } catch(NullPointerException ex) {
  4.   fixedExcludedParams.add("nombre_solicitante");
  5. }

Etiquetas: Ninguno
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 22:15.